  14. I found Ruckus to have a lot of liberal thought/voices on it. Yeah, there were people like Woody Cozad and even Shannin himself were conservatives. Patrick Twohy is part of the Show Me Institute and is more of a conservative (although I believe the institute labels itself as more Libertarian) and he was on the show semi-regularly. But the show had plenty of liberals on there that supported a lot of the tax/borrow/spend ways of our city government i.e. Mary O'Halloran, Jon Stephens of Port KC, etc.

    Yes there was a good amount of conservatism on the show but there was also a lot of liberal representation too. If anything, it leaned slightly more left IMO. But both sides, in general, were represented on the show. There were weeks where it leaned more one way than the other. But in general, both sides had at least one voice on the show.

    As the article mentioned, if I want pure opinion one way or the other, I'll go to one of the cable "news" (and I use that term very lightly) outlets i.e. CNN, FoxNews, etc. I thought Ruckus did one of the better jobs of representing both sides. And it's a real shame in a world where news has been replaced by pure, unadulterated and often times vicious, biased sprinkled with mis-information, we cancel a show that represents varying viewpoints.

    The problem that no one wants to cop to is the fact that KC is a liberal run city. And having too many conservative thoughts and voices about the city may upset the machine.
